What is Going on Today

South Station subway extension opens.

4.30--Lecture on Mathematical Logic. IV. "Problems in Postulate Theory," by Dr. H. M. Sheffer '05, Emerson A.

5.00--Physical Colloquium. "The Effect of Pressure on the Electrical Resistance of Metals," I., by Professor P. W. Bridgeman '04. Jefferson Physical laboratory 3.

6.30--Phi Beta Kappa initiation of new members; 7.00--Dinner in Union.

7.00--University gymnastic team candidates report in Hemenway Gymnasium.

8.00--Modern Language Conference, "Concerning the Style of Heinrich von Kleist," by Professor W. G. Howard '91. Conant Common Room.
